Home » Cloud Platform Engineer Job at RBC – Nova Scotia, Canada | Apply Now

Cloud Platform Engineer Job at RBC – Nova Scotia, Canada | Apply Now

Cloud Platform Engineer Job at RBC – Nova Scotia, Canada | Apply Now

Introduction:
Looking to propel your career in cloud computing? RBC is hiring a Staff Cloud Platform Engineer for its innovative technology and operations platform in Nova Scotia, Canada. Join our team and drive modernization with industry-leading cloud solutions and OpenShift platform expertise.


Optimized Job Advertisement Content:

About the Role
As a Cloud Platform Engineer at Royal Bank of Canada (RBC), you’ll have a unique opportunity to enhance RBC’s cloud infrastructure, specifically by delivering and optimizing our OpenShift platform-as-a-service. This role is central to our technology transformation, supporting over 1,500 applications and focusing on stability, security, and top-notch customer experience. Cloud Platform Engineer

Responsibilities:

  • Manage and enhance the OpenShift platform to support internal app development.
  • Apply SRE principles, ensuring robust automation for scalable service delivery within defined SLOs.
  • Oversee and refine onboarding processes, ensuring client satisfaction and continuous improvement.
  • Collaborate with cross-functional teams for efficient service delivery.
  • Establish best practices for cloud infrastructure, ensuring smooth deployment and maintenance. Cloud Platform Engineer

Skills and Qualifications

  • Required:
  • Hands-on experience with RedHat OpenShift or enterprise Kubernetes platforms.
  • Minimum of 5 years in operational roles (e.g., DevOps, SRE), with strong experience in Java, NodeJS, .NET Core, or Python.
  • Familiarity with Terraform, Ansible, CI/CD pipelines, and GitHub.
  • Proficiency in automation tools (Helm, Tiller, Kustomize) and SCM tools.
  • Nice to Have:
  • Knowledge of API documentation tools (Swagger, RAML).
  • Experience with Dynatrace, Prometheus, Grafana, ELK, Splunk. Cloud Platform Engineer

Why Join RBC?

  • Be part of an innovative, collaborative team.
  • Opportunities for professional development.
  • Work with emerging technologies, including cloud and automation.
  • Supportive management and a comprehensive rewards program.


Also you may like

Leave a Reply

Your email address will not be published. Required fields are marked *